Assessments/Screeners administered at PRA as part of an Occupational Therapy Evaluation:
- The Beery-Buktenica Developmental Test of Visual-Motor Integration, 6th Edition with Supplemental Developmental Tests of Visual Perception and Motor Coordination (VMI)
- The Evaluation Tool of Children's Handwriting (ETCH)
- The Sensory Processing Measure (SPM)
- The Bruininks-Oseretsky Test of Motor Proficiency, 2nd Edition (BOT-2)
- The Handwriting Without Tears Screener
- The Occupational Therapy K-2nd and 3rd-5th Fine Motor Screener
- The Assisted Technology (AT) for Writing Screener
- The Print Tool
